Medicines

The most popular treatment for ADHD is medication. They regulate the natural brain chemicals that regulate your mood and impulses. They can also help you focus and concentrate. They can also cause side effects, and they are not cure. You'll need to discuss the medication with your physician and be monitored closely. Typically, they'll need to visit you regularly for checkups and to adjust your dosage if needed.

Behavioral Therapies

While medications are the most common treatment for ADHD, it is also important to find a type of therapy that is effective for you. This type of treatment uses various methods to deal with unwanted behaviors and teach them positive alternatives. It is usually utilized in conjunction with medication. Role-playing and modelling are two of these techniques. These kinds of therapy are effective because it allows people to observe their behavior change in real life situations.

Behavioral therapy has been proven to be extremely beneficial for those suffering from ADHD. It teaches them how to improve their daily functioning and deal with their symptoms. It can be combined with other treatments, such as psychotherapy, cognitive behavioral therapy, and support groups. It can be used to teach children about ADHD, and ways to manage it.
